python打造名片管理系统,小白入门最佳练手项目!
2018-12-15 本文已影响2人
编程新视野
名片管理小系统
名片信息包含姓名、电话、QQ;
系统功能:增加用户信息、修改信息、删除信息、查询信息、退出系统、打印名片;
操作为:用户每次都可以进行选择,直到用户选择退出系统为止;
学习Python中有不明白推荐加入交流群
号:943752371
群里有志同道合的小伙伴,互帮互助,
群里有不错的视频学习教程和PDF!
先定义一个选项页面,根据用户的选择把返回值赋给choose:
根据用户的选择,做出不同的相关操作:
其中,为了让代码更加简洁,把一部分代码进行封装:
总结:修改、删除、查询这三个功能首要任务都是先确定这个用户信息,所以查找很关键。该代码中用姓名作为查找关键(电话、QQ亦可),通过searchName函数来完成;添加名片时使用了字典功能,即addCard函数中定义的new_card;退出系统可直接运用break。
Python回顾
1.print输出语句
语句用单引号、双引号、三引号均可;三引号可多行注释;
2.变量
3.逻辑判断
4.while循环
5.for循环